- API (データ&プログラム) -API(data&program)

予察情報API(作物一覧取得):getyosatsuproduct

提供ベンダー:
システム名:
予察情報API
利用条件:
オプションAPI(提供者へ申込必要)

概要

API名称
予察情報API(作物一覧取得)
説明

都道府県の防除所が公開している病害虫の発生予察情報を提供いたします。
・都道府県のホームページ等で公開している情報です。
・本APIで提供される情報の改変は一切行わないでください。
・本APIは令和7年3月末まで、無料でご利用いただけます。
・本APIご利用のお申し込みは、添付ファイルの「予察情報API利用規約」をご確認のうえ、「予察情報API利用申請書」を
(株)ファーム・アライアンスマネジメント(support@farmalliance.net)までご提出お願いいたします。

データの更新頻度
随時(日時処理)
カテゴリー

リクエスト

URL

https://api.wagri.net/API/Individual/fam/yosatsuinfo/getyosatsuproduct?page={page}

説明
HTTPメソッド
GET
パラメータ

認証(AUTHORIZATION)

キー

X-YosatsuAPI-Token

{User_Token}

 

ヘッダー(HEADERS)

キー

X-Authorization

{WAGR_Token}

 

パラメータ(PARAMS)

名称

値の説明

page

ページ番号

数値

ページング(0=全件)

呼出例

https://api.wagri.net/API/Individual/fam/yosatsuinfo/getyosatsuproduct?page=1

レスポンス

レイアウト

予察病害虫データ API レスポンス

このAPIは、予察の病害虫データ、ブロック情報などを取得します。

レスポンスデータ

名称

説明

status

数値

処理結果

total_count

数値

検索結果の合計数

page_size

数値

ページ当たりの構成数

page

数値

ページ数

content

配列

検索結果

 

検索結果 (content)

名称

説明

MstHykdamage

オブジェクト

管理病害虫マスタデータ

 

管理病害虫マスタデータ (MstHykdamage)

名称

説明

ID

文字列

ID

UCD

文字列

ユニークコード

MCD

文字列

マスタコード

F_HYUCD

文字列

ローカルマスタコード

NAME

文字列

名称

KANA

文字列

カナ名

PUBCD

文字列

公開区分

F_PRFCD

文字列

管理都道府県コード

USECD

文字列

使用区分

EXTREFCD

文字列

参照コード

REMARKS

文字列

備考

IMGPATH

文字列

画像URL

CRDT

文字列

初回登録日時

F_CRCD

文字列

初回登録者コード

CHDT

文字列

最終更新日時

F_CHCD

文字列

最終更新者コード

ISDEL

文字列

削除フラグ

ISAVL

文字列

有効フラグ

LOCALNAME

配列

ローカル名

レスポンス例
{
"status": 200,
"total_count": 75,
"page_size": 10,
"page": 1,
"content": [
{
"MstHykproduct": {
"ID": 1,
"UCD": 80001,
"MCD": 10,
"F_HYUCD": 0,
"NAME": "いちご",
"KANA": "",
"PUBCD": 1,
"F_PRFCD": 0,
"USECD": 1,
"EXTREFCD": "",
"REMARKS": "",
"IMGPATH": null,
"CRDT": "2021-10-20 13:47:00",
"F_CRCD": 0,
"CHDT": "2021-11-02 14:47:00", 
"F_CHCD": 0,
"ISDEL": 0,
"ISAVL": 1,
"LOCALNAME": [ 
{
"MstHyuproduct": {
"ID": 1,
"UCD": 80001,
"MCD": 1,
"F_HYUCD": 17,
"F_PRODCD": 10,
"NAME": "いちご",
"KANA": "イチゴ",
"EXTREFCD": "",
"REMARKS": null,
"IMGPATH": null,
"CRDT": "2023-05-10 13:55:13", 
"F_CRCD": 0,
"CHDT": "2023-05-10 13:55:13", 
"F_CHCD": 0,
"ISDEL": 0,
"ISAVL": 1 
},
"MstApp": {
"MCD": 17, 
"NAME": "石川県" 
}, 
"MstPrefecture": {
"MCD": 17,
"NAME": "石川県" 
} 
} 
]
} 
}
}
ステータスコード

コード

名称

値の説明

200

OK

リクエストが成功しました。

400

Bad Request

リクエストが不正です。

401

Unauthorized

認証情報が不正です。

403

Forbidden

リソースのアクセスが禁止されています。

404

Not Found

リソースが見つかりませんでした。

500

Internal Server Error

サーバー内部でエラーが発生しました。

サンプルソースコード

ソースコード

Python(requestsモジュール)でのサンプルコード

import requests
url = "https://api.wagri.net/API/Individual/fam/yosatsuinfo/getmstprefecture?page=1"
payload = {}
headers = {
'X-Authorization': '{WAGRI_Token}',
'X-YosatsuAPI-Token': 'User_Token',
'Cookie': 'ARRAffinity={}; ARRAffinitySameSite={}'
}
response = requests.request("GET", url, headers=headers, data=payload)
print(response.text)
前に戻る
上部へスクロール
Scroll to Top